مُحَوِّل CSV إلى XML

بياناتمطورنص
إعلان · حذف؟

خيارات

إعلان · حذف؟

مرشد

مُحول CSV إلى XML

مُحَوِّل CSV إلى XML

أعد تحويل أي ملف CSV إلى XML نظيف وموصوف دون مغادرة المتصفح. الصق أو ارفع بياناتك، اختر طريقة تطابق السطور والعنوان، واحصل على XML مُفرَّغ بشكل صحيح مع معالجة الحالات الخاصة (العلامات، الأقواس، الاقتباسات، الأسطر المُضمنة) تلقائيًا.

يتم تشغيل كل شيء من جانب العميل، لذا لا يغادر ملفك أبدًا. هذا يجعله آمنًا لسجلات، التصديرات، وجميع الأوراق التي لا ترغب في الصقها في خدمة خارجية.

كيفية استخدام

  1. أدخل CSV في مربع الإدخال، أو ارفع ملفًا .csv باستخدام المُرفع.
  2. اختر المُحدد (الفاصلة، الفاصلة المائلة، التباعد، الأنبوب) وحدد ما إذا كانت السطر الأول تحتوي على عناوين.
  3. حدد اسم العنصر الجذري، اسم عنصر السطر، وتحديد ما إذا كان يجب أن تُعرض العناوين كعناصر فرعية أو خصائص.
  4. اختر نمط التسجيل، قم بتفعيل إعلان XML، واختر الترميز.
  5. انسخ النتيجة أو احفظها كملف .xml.

خصائص

  • تحليل نمط RFC 4180 – يتعامل مع الحقول المُقتَصَّة، الاقتباسات المُفردة، والأسطر داخل الخلايا.
  • أسماء عناصر مخصصة – اختر أسماء الجذري، السطر، وعند استخدام نمط الموضع، أسماء عنصر الحقل.
  • العناوين كعناصر أو خصائص – التبديل بين <row><name>Alice</name></row> و <row name="Alice"/>.
  • الترميز الصارم للـ XML – معالجة الأدوار الخاصة بـ &, <, >, "، والرموز المُسيطرة في الخصائص.
  • مرونة في الناتج – مسافات 2، 4، أو تباعد، مع إعلان اختياري للـ XML والتشفير.
  • أسماء عناصر آمنة – يتم تنظيف الأحرف غير المسموحة في العناوين تلقائيًا.
  • تحميل .xml – تصدير بسيط للملف المُولَّد.

إعلان · حذف؟

التعليمات

  1. ما هو CSV وما السبب في انتشاره حتى الآن؟

    CSV (قيم مفصولة بفاصلة) هو تنسيق نصي جدول، حيث يُمثل كل سطر سجلًا، والحقول مفصولة بمُحدد. يُستمر في الانتشار لأنه سهل الإنتاج، سهل القراءة، ويمكن لأي برنامج جدول أو قاعدة بيانات أو أداة تحليل أن يُدخل أو يُخرج منه دون نموذج.

  2. ما هو استخدام XML اليوم؟

    الـ XML هو تنسيق مُحدد للإشارات، ويُستخدم في ملفات التكوين، تنسيقات الوثائق (DOCX، SVG، RSS)، تبادل البيانات في المؤسسات (SOAP، تدفقات مالية، تقارير حكومية)، وفي أي مكان يُفضل استخدام نموذج صارم وذو وصف مُحدد مع خصائص وعناصر مُتداخلة بدلاً من CSV أو JSON غير المُحدد.

  3. لماذا يحتاج XML إلى ترميز الأدوار؟

    الرموز &، جزء من بنية XML. إذا ظهرت بشكل حر في النص، فإنها تتعارض مع العلامات وتُسبب توقف التحليل. يتم ترميز هذه الرموز باستخدام أحداث XML (&amp؛، &lt؛، &gt؛، &quot؛، &apos؛) بحيث يُحتفظ بالنص دون أن يُفسد الملف.

  4. ما هي قواعد اسم عنصر XML صالح؟

    يجب أن يبدأ اسم عنصر XML بحرف أو تحت خط، ويمكن أن يليه أحرف، أرقام، خطوط، تحت خط، أو نقاط. لا يُسمح بمسافات، أشرطة، أو معظم الرموز، ويُحتفظ بعناوين تبدأ بـ "xml" (بأي حالة) وفقًا للمعيار.

  5. في أي وقت يجب أن تكون العناوين خصائص بدلًا من عناصر فرعية؟

    تُستخدم الخصائص بشكل جيد لبيانات مختصرة مثل الأرقام، الأعلام، أو التصنيفات، وتُنتج XML أكثر كثافة. أما العناصر الفرعية فهي أفضل عندما يمكن أن تحتوي على محتوى مُهيكل، أو تحتاج لخصائص لاحقًا، أو عندما يتوقع المستهلك تمرير العناصر عبر XPath.

هل تريد حذف الإعلانات؟ تخلص من الإعلانات اليوم

تثبيت ملحقاتنا

أضف أدوات IO إلى متصفحك المفضل للوصول الفوري والبحث بشكل أسرع

أضف لـ إضافة كروم أضف لـ امتداد الحافة أضف لـ إضافة فايرفوكس أضف لـ ملحق الأوبرا

وصلت لوحة النتائج!

لوحة النتائج هي طريقة ممتعة لتتبع ألعابك، يتم تخزين جميع البيانات في متصفحك. المزيد من الميزات قريبا!

إعلان · حذف؟
إعلان · حذف؟
إعلان · حذف؟

ركن الأخبار مع أبرز التقنيات

شارك

ساعدنا على الاستمرار في تقديم أدوات مجانية قيمة

اشتري لي قهوة
إعلان · حذف؟